Tracy, CA Crime Statistics

Crime Overview

The Tracy Police Department serves the city of Tracy, CA in San Joaquin County. Over the past five years (2019-2024), the city recorded 3,554 violent crimes and 8,019 property crimes. The average violent crime rate stands at 65.4 per 100k residents, which is 38.4% below the national average. Property crime averages 187.2 per 100k, 14.4% above the national average. The most common offense was Property Crime, while Rape had the lowest rate. Over the same period, the city also reported 20 hate crime incidents, with motivations including race, religion, and sexual orientation. Data is sourced from the FBI Crime Data Explorer and reflects totals from the most recent five-year period.
